You will have the opportunity to cast your ballot in the 2024 Primary Election on or before Tuesday, March 5. All UCI community members are encouraged to take part in the election and make your voices heard. Voting in Orange County is easy and secure.

In-person same-day registration and voting

If you are not registered to vote, you may register in person on March 5 and cast your ballot. You must be 18 years old or older, a U.S. citizen, and reside in Orange County to complete the same-day voting process at an Orange County Vote Center. Find a vote center at ocvote.gov/votecenter.

In-person voting at the UCI Student Center

The vote center at the UCI Student Center is open for early voting and for voting on March 5. Hours:

  • Saturday, March 2 - Monday, March 4, from 8 a.m. to 8 p.m.
  • Tuesday, March 5, from 7 a.m. to 8 p.m.

Mail-in or drop box voting

All currently registered California voters received a ballot in the mail. You can vote by returning the ballot in the mail on or before election day or by dropping it off at one of the ballot drop-off locations.

  • UCI has a ballot drop box (off Pereira Drive near Mesa Court Housing and Parking Lot 5).

For questions, contact the Registrar of Voters at (714) 567-7600 or (888) OCVOTES or visit ocvote.gov.
